Comprehending FSSAI Licences: Your Guide to Compliance

Operating a food business in India requires adhering to stringent regulations set by the Food Safety and Standards Authority of India (FSSAI). One crucial aspect of compliance is obtaining an FSSAI licence, which validates your adherence to food safety standards. This manual provides a comprehensive overview of FSSAI licences, helping you understand the necessities and navigate the application process effectively.

Firstly, it's essential to recognize the type of licence you require based on your food business type. The FSSAI offers various licence categories, ranging from small-scale operations to large-scale processors.

Each category has specific criteria that must be met. For instance, a food manufacturer would require a different licence compared to a restaurant. Once you've recognized the appropriate licence category, you need to compile the required documents. This typically includes your business registration certificate, proof of premises, and other relevant details.

After submitting your application online or offline, the FSSAI will conduct an assessment to confirm your compliance with food safety regulations. Upon successful fulfillment of this process, you will be issued an FSSAI licence, which is effective for a specified period.

It's crucial to remember that maintaining compliance with FSSAI regulations is an ongoing task. Regular inspections may be conducted to ensure your food business continues to operate safely and legally.

Keeping Your FSSAI Licence: Renewals and Audits

Securing more info your FSSAI licence is a crucial step for any food business in India. But, the journey doesn't end there. Once you have your licence, it's vital to understand how to maintain it through scheduled renewals and possible audits.

A well-maintained FSSAI licence not only confirms your commitment to quality standards, but also helps you avoid any regulatory complications.

Typically, your FSSAI licence has a validity period of one year. Before it expires, you'll need to file for renewal with the relevant authorities. The renewal process usually involves submitting updated documents and settling the required fee.

In addition to renewals, your food business may be subject to audits by FSSAI officials at any point in time. These reviews are designed to ensure that your operations are meeting the prescribed safety and hygiene standards.

Get ready for these audits by keeping accurate records, implementing good manufacturing practices (GMP), and training on food safety protocols.
